Stefan Nemanja, the Grand Prince of the Serbian Grand Principality, expanded his domain by seizing the area along the White Drin River. This region, significant for its strategic position and fertile land, came under the control of the Nemanjić dynasty, marking a critical phase in the consolidation of Serbian medieval statehood. Stefan Nemanja’s campaign into this area marked his efforts to strengthen and stabilize his rule, both politically and militarily. With the region's acquisition, Nemanja bolstered the economic base of his domain through the control of vital agricultural lands and trade routes. The White Drin River region provided a crucial link between different parts of the Balkans, enhancing the connectivity and power of the Serbian state. This territorial expansion also had several long-term impacts. It laid the groundwork for future generations of the Nemanjić dynasty to build a more cohesive and powerful Serbian state, eventually transforming it into a kingdom and later an empire. The incorporation of the White Drin River region into Serbia fostered cultural and religious developments, with the introduction and spread of Orthodox Christianity and significant ecclesiastical institutions serving as centers of learning and governance. The seizure of this area facilitated the strategic positioning of Serbia against regional rivals and played a part in the power dynamics of the Balkans. It contributed to the geopolitical landscape by establishing Serbia as a formidable player capable of influencing regional affairs.
